Ethereum Trading Analysis: Bearish Trend Continues

The cryptocurrency market has been experiencing a significant decline in recent days, with Ethereum (ETHUSD) being no exception. As of writing, the current price of ETHUSD is $1978, representing a 0.25% decrease in the last 24 hours. The overall trend for Ethereum remains bearish, with the 5-day high of $2199 and 5-day low of $1930 indicating a volatile market.

Market Overview

The recent decline in the cryptocurrency market can be attributed to a combination of factors, including regulatory concerns and a general market correction. The ongoing regulatory crackdown in China has caused a major sell-off in the market, with many investors concerned about the future of cryptocurrencies in the country. Additionally, the market has been experiencing a correction after reaching record highs earlier this year.

Technical Analysis

From a technical standpoint, the current price of ETHUSD is below both the 50-day and 200-day moving averages, indicating a bearish trend. The 5-day high of $2199 serves as a strong resistance level, while the 5-day low of $1930 provides support. Traders should pay close attention to these levels when making trading decisions.
